B1424

Solar Sensor Circuit Driver Side

B1424 is an OBD-II diagnostic trouble code meaning: Solar Sensor Circuit Driver Side. Common causes: open or short circuit in the sensor circuit, poor contact in the sensor connector. Estimated repair cost: $56–167.

Severity
⚠️ Medium
Can you drive?
Yes, but get it checked soon
Approx. repair cost
$56–167 (est.)

Symptoms

  • Incorrect operation of climate control
  • Lack of automatic temperature adjustment when lighting changes
  • Check Engine Light Illuminates

Causes

  • Open or short circuit in the sensor circuit
  • Poor contact in the sensor connector
  • Failure of the light sensor
  • Wiring Harness Problems
  • Malfunction of the climate control unit

How to Fix

  1. Check the integrity of the sensor wiring harness
  2. Check connections and contacts in connectors
  3. Test the light sensor with a multimeter
  4. Replace sensor if necessary
  5. Reset the error and check the system operation
